    On a recent Saturday trek out to Printemps to take advantage of the last days of the soldes I found myself starving to death midway through the walk. How was there nothing open? Not even a bakery, or one of those over-, under-designed expensive health food chains like Cojean? I started to panic. Then, just as I began accepting our worst case scenario (the food stalls at Galeries Lafayette) I noticed a friendly looking awning with a goofy name and glowing lights inside. Salvation! Krêp (I love the name!) is a sit-down or take-away crepe restaurant with an air of Scandinavian chic. The blue and wood design is simple and tasteful and the chalkboard menu filled with many tempting sweet and savory options. The crepes are relatively inexpensive and freshly made right before your eyes. My goat cheese and tomato crepe was crispy on the edges and fluffy on the inside, with a nice crepe to filling ratio. There's also a cute selection of pantry items, like sarrasin flour and cider that you can purchase to go. All in all it was the perfect spot to gather our resources before a few hours of intense bargain hunting, plus a quiet location to feed our little tyke too.

    Very nice crepes at a competitive price. You can opt for one of two set price menus, either 9 euros or 11.50 euros (I believe) which offer increasingly complex options for each of two crepes, a savory one (aka a galette) and a sweet one. Both options come with a drink. My sister tried the goat cheese galette and the nutella crepe (the lower priced menu) and I went with the smoked salmon galette and apple crisp dessert crepe. All of them are highly recommended, but my favorite was the smoked salmon.
